Q2 2024 Performance of Top Fitness Apps in Australia on iOS

In the second quarter of 2024, Australia has seen notable activity in the iOS fitness and weight loss app market. Sensor Tower provides insights into the performance of the top applications in this category.

MyFitnessPal: Calorie Counter maintained a strong presence with revenues fluctuating between $85K and $100K, peaking towards the end of the quarter. Downloads showed an upward trend from around 5K to over 6K, while weekly active users varied, reaching a high of over 280K in late May.

Strava: Run, Bike, Hike experienced a decrease in revenue from $81K to around $70K by mid-June, before rebounding to $77K. Downloads started at 12K and dipped to just above 7K, then slightly recovered. Active users stayed largely within the 170K to 190K range.

Runna: Running Training Plans showed consistency in revenue, hovering around $40K to $50K, with a noticeable peak in late June. Downloads saw a decline from approximately 2.8K to 2.1K. Active users remained relatively stable, with a peak of over 12K in early June.

Kic: Health, Fitness & Recipes saw its revenue dip from $50K to $27K in early May, then surged to nearly $50K by the quarter's end. Downloads remained under 1K, displaying a slight increase towards June. Weekly active users were consistent, with a small peak of 3.6K mid-June.

AllTrails: Hike, Bike & Run observed a revenue range between $26K and $37K, ending the quarter slightly lower than it started. Downloads began at approximately 7.3K, decreased mid-quarter, and then plateaued around 6K. Active user numbers showed growth in May, reaching over 25K.
